Neuro-endocrine tumours of the abdomen have long constituted a therapeutic challenge. Although characterised by slow growth rates, these tumours produce peptides and amines which in turn give rise to more or less severe clinical symptoms. Surgery has been deemed the treatment of choice, and is to be considered even in cases of metastasising disease. Medical treatment includes chemotherapy, and treatment with somatostatin analogues and interferons. By means of long-term treatment with alpha-interferon (leukocyte interferon), the disease can be controlled for long periods.

Surgery has always been considered to be the primary treatment in patients with neuroendocrine gut and pancreatic tumors, but a significant number of patients present liver metastases already at the first visit. There is obviously a need for effective medical treatment and in the present paper we report our experience of treatment with chemotherapy, the somatostatin analogue SMS 201-995 and interferons. In 30 patients with malignant endocrine pancreatic tumors, chemotherapy including streptozotocin plus 5-fluorouracil had an objective response rate of 63% with a mean duration of the objective response of 17.4 months. There was a difference between clinically functioning and nonfunctioning tumors, which had objective response rates of 68% and 50% and mean response duration of 21 and 9.4 months respectively. The new somatostatin analogue SMS 201-995 was used in 10 patients giving an objective response rate of 40% with a mean duration of 13.5 months. In a series of 22 patients treated with human leukocyte interferon, an objective response rate of 77% was obtained with a mean duration of 8.5 months. A combination of streptozotocin plus 5-fluorouracil gave an objective response rate of 10% with a mean duration of 2.7 months among 31 patients with midgut carcinoid tumors. The somatostatin analogue SMS 201-995, tested in 22 patients with carcinoid tumors, gave an objective response rate of 28% with a mean duration of 18.5 months. Interferon has been tried in three separate studies. The first study, including 36 patients with malignant carcinoid tumors treated with human leukocyte interferon, showed an objective response rate of 47% with a mean duration of 34 months. In a randomized controlled study, where human leukocyte interferon was compared with streptozotocin plus 5-fluorouracil including 10 patients in each arm, no objective response was obtained during the six months' observation in the group of patients receiving chemotherapy, whereas 50% responded in the interferon-treated group. In the third study, IFN-alpha 2b or IntronA was tested in 20 patients with malignant carcinoid tumors and gave an objective response rate of 55% during a six-month observation period. With regard to these data chemotherapy and interferons seem to be equally potent in the treatment of malignant endocrine pancreatic tumors, whereas interferons seem to be superior to both chemotherapy and the somatostatin analogue SMS 201-995 in malignant carcinoid tumors. The somatostatin analogue has proved to be particularly useful in the treatment of patients with severe hormone-related clinical symptoms and in the perioperative period.(ABSTRACT TRUNCATED AT 400 WORDS)

A 69 year-old male with carcinoid syndrome and undetectable primary tumour, but disseminated liver metastases, was treated with somatostatin analogue octreotide (Sandostatin) and later additionally with recombinant interferon alpha 2 b (r IFN alpha 2 b, Intron A). The carcinoid symptoms (flushing, diarrhoea) were stopped within hours by octreotide. Simultaneously, the urinary 5-hydroxyindolacetic acid (5-HIAA) excretion and serum serotonin levels decreased by more than 50%. In spite of continued treatment with r IFN alpha 2 b a reduction in dosage of octreotide resulted in a rapid recurrence of carcinoid symptoms, suggesting that IFN alpha 2 b had no effect on the carcinoid symptoms in this patient. Since, furthermore, no regression of the tumour mass was observed, treatment with IFN was stopped after 8 months. During 15 months of treatment to date the patient has been kept free of symptoms by octreotide.

Neuroendocrine liver metastases are rare, yet they represent an entity that has attracted much attention lately. The protracted course of neuroendocrine tumors and the hormone origin of their typical incapacitating symptoms constitute a logical basis for well founded and bespoke treatment. Demonstration of the liver secondaries is best done by ultrasonography (US) and contrast-enhanced computed tomography (CT), which on the whole have replaced the invasive angiography techniques. By use of histochemical and molecular biologic methods the exact nature of the tumor can be typified in tissue samples obtained percutaneously, laparoscopically, or surgically. Localization of nonpalpable metastases of the liver is best done by intraoperative US. Surgical removal of liver metastases is curative in some cases and is usually effective in relieving the symptoms. Also, palliative debulking or cytoreductive surgery is often worthwhile as it offers a chance of prolonged survival and symptom relief. Similar benefits are achieved by ischemic therapy preferably by temporary dearterialization, which in our department is done on an outpatient basis using a specially designed (externally controlled) occluder applied during a single laparotomy that includes debulking when appropriate as well as cholecystectomy. Hormonal therapy with somatostatin analogs may be used as a single treatment or in combination with ischemic therapy. It has an ensured symptom-reducing effect, whereas its influence on tumor growth is unsettled. Lately similar effects have been ascribed to human leukocyte interferon. In conclusion the specific characteristics of neuroendocrine tumors and the available treatment arsenal favor an active treatment approach in patients who have developed liver metastases.
